Rare Auld Single Malt Scotch Whisky 

Distilled at
IMPERIAL DISTILLERY

SPEYSIDE

The Imperial distillery was established in 1897 by Thomas Mackenzie, then taken over soon after by Dailuaine-Talisker Distilleries Ltd in 1898. Production of the spririt ceased in 1899, but only for 20 years. Production thereafter was sporadic yet constant for many years until 1998, when the Imperial distilery was unfortunately mothballed.

Tasting Notes
Bottling: Duncan Taylor Imperial 1982 - 22yo Single Malt Scotch Whisky. Duncan Taylor Single Malt Scotch
Cask No: 3788.
Colour: Pale Gold.
Nose: Fresh, sherbet like with a hint of smoky bacon crisps.
Flavour: Full and coating, creamy and a little wood.
Finish: Lemony and zingy with a touch of spice.
Comments:  A complex lemony dram.

Bottling: Whisky Galore Imperial 1994 - 12yo Single Malt Scotch Whisky. Whisky Galore Single Malt Scotch
Cask No: NA - 46%.
Colour: Pale Gold.
Nose: Green fruitiness and pine air freshner.
Flavour: Apple Tart and cream.
Finish: More creaminess develops in the finish.
Comments:  A stunningly refreshing dram.
